ACRRM Dermatology Webinar - "Virtual Dermatology Outpatients: Skin Rash and Skin Cancer Cases" - Thursday 23 April 2026

Date: Thursday 23 April 2026
Duration: 90 minutes
CPD: 1.5 hours
Presenters: Dr Jim Muir and Dr Dan Kennedy


Overview

Virtual dermatology outpatient models are increasingly being used to support timely, high-quality dermatological care, particularly in rural and remote settings. These models allow clinicians to manage common and high-risk skin conditions with specialist input while reducing unnecessary patient travel and delays in care.


Learning outcomes

By the end of this webinar, participants should be able to:

  • Recognise common inflammatory skin rashes suitable for virtual assessment and management.

  • Identify suspicious skin lesions and skin cancers that require urgent referral or biopsy.

  • Improve clinical photography and documentation to enhance diagnostic accuracy in virtual consultations.
